Healthy Breakfast Ideas on the Go

With a little bit of planning the night before, you can come up with grab-and-go breakfast ideas. The following are a few ideas for healthy breakfast foods on the go.

Whole Grain Muffins: One of the classic healthy breakfast foods on the go is a whole grain muffin. Spread on peanut butter, which not only provides you with the necessary proteins but needless to say, is very tasty too! You can always buy muffins the day before. This requires no time for preparation, so you will not have any excuse to skip breakfast anymore.

Fruit Smoothie: A great idea for healthy breakfast foods is a fruit smoothie. You can make these delicious drinks with any of your favorite fruits. A great combination is kiwis, bananas, strawberries, raspberries, milk and low fat natural yogurt. This does not require more than five minutes, and is extremely healthy, not to mention deliciously tasty!

Peanut Butter Roll Ups: If you have extra tortilla wraps left at home, then one option for healthy breakfast foods for people in a hurry is to spread whole grain tortillas with peanut or almond nut butter with bananas, and roll them up! If you are not a fan of bananas, you have the option of making it with any other fruit that you like.

Oatmeal: Oatmeal is the most nutritious breakfast you can have. Now I know that the first thing that comes to mind is that you do not have the time. But a great idea is to prepare it the night before and store it in the fridge. All you have to do is heat it in the morning and you have a ready healthy breakfast on the go!

Yogurt and Granola Bars: Now what can be tastier than yogurt and granola bars? Just pour out low fat yogurt, granola bars or any other whole grain cereal of choice with berries in a cup. If you are in a hurry and want to eat it on the way, then just put it in a paper cup and your delicious and easy breakfast is ready!

Other Ideas for Healthy Breakfasts on the Go
  • Cheese slices melted on whole wheat toast
  • Whole grain bagel spread with hummus and thin apple slices
  • Whole wheat pita stuffed with low-fat cottage cheese and fresh fruit
  • English muffin topped with any form of eggs; scrambled egg, egg substitute, or egg whites and topped with a cheese slice
  • Tortilla filled with scrambled eggs, egg substitute, or egg whites and topped with salsa sauce
  • Whole wheat crackers and cheese, apple wedges
